Quinn Freeman may have won the race around the world, but when a new enemy appears he must travel beyond the edge of the map once more. Quinn is back! He finished his race around the world and is living a quiet life on the family farm, until he discovers that the King's enemies want to capture him. Quinn is forced to go on the run, taking to the high seas once more. Can he survive when he is double-crossed and left for dead? BEYOND THE EDGE OF THE MAP is another thrilling adventure from A. L. This report assesses domestic political support for internationalist foreign policy by analyzing the motivations of members of Congress on key foreign policy issues. It includes case studies on major foreign policy debates in recent years. Report findings emphasize areas of bipartisan cooperation on foreign policy issues given member ideologies.
